 Use of 3-Indoleacetic acid


Indole-3-acetic acid (3-Indoleacetic acid; IAA) is the most common natural plant growth hormone of the auxin class. It can be added to cell culture medium to induce plant cell elongation and division.

 Chemical & Physical Properties

Density 1.4±0.1 g/cm3
Boiling Point 415.0±20.0 °C at 760 mmHg
Melting Point 165-169 °C(lit.)
Molecular Formula C10H9NO2
Molecular Weight 175.184
Flash Point 204.8±21.8 °C
Exact Mass 175.063324
PSA 53.09000
LogP 1.43
Vapour Pressure 0.0±1.0 mmHg at 25°C
Index of Refraction 1.694
Storage condition −20°C
